Apple and Blue Cheese Bisque

Ingredients:
1 tablespoon unsalted butter
2 cups peeled, cored, small dice apples
1 cup half and half
5 to 6 ounces blue cheese, crumbled
1/4 teaspoon salt, to taste
1/4 teaspoon freshly ground white pepper, to taste

Preparations:
Heat the butter in a saucepan, over a medium flame. Add the apples and saute for 1 to 2 minutes, until softened. Add the half & half or milk and reduce heat to low. Heat and stir until the mixture begins to scald around the edges. Gradually add the cheese and stir until melted. Season to taste with salt and pepper. Serve hot.
